Ensemble of the solution structures of domain one of receptor associated protein
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 12766414
About this Structure
1OV2 is a Single protein structure of sequence from Homo sapiens. Full experimental information is available from OCA.
Reference
1H, 13C and 15N resonance assignments of domain 1 of receptor associated protein., Wu Y, Migliorini M, Yu P, Strickland DK, Wang YX, J Biomol NMR. 2003 Jun;26(2):187-8. PMID:12766414
